DSR Help!

I bought an E1505 last week and it came with a 100GB hard disk partitioned to 65GB Windows NTFS/ 20GB NTFS/ 8GB FAT32. It has Windows XP Media Center installed.
 
I would like to use Dell's DSR to recover the XP but got a message about no recovery point. The output from dsrfix is:
 
DSRFIX - Dell DSR Analyzer, version 2.20
Copyright 2005-2006 by Dan Goodell, all rights reserved.
 ùgood : int13 extensions supported.
 ùgood : boot code matches dell mbr v3.
 ùgood : pbr descriptor 1 is type DE.
 ùgood : pbr descriptor 2 is type 07.
 alert: pbr descriptor 3 is type 05, not DB.
 ùinfo : pbr descriptor 4 is type DB.
 ùgood : pbr1 is fat16, label is DellUtility.
 fatal: pbr3 is not fat32.
 alert: reference partition table not in sync.
 
When I use the /PBR4 switch the output is:
DSRFIX - Dell DSR Analyzer, version 2.20
Copyright 2005-2006 by Dan Goodell, all rights reserved.
 ùgood : int13 extensions supported.
 ùgood : boot code matches dell mbr v3.
 ùgood : pbr descriptor 1 is type DE.
 ùgood : pbr descriptor 2 is type 07.
 ùinfo : pbr descriptor 3 is type 05.
 ùgood : pbr descriptor 4 is type DB.
 ùgood : pbr1 is fat16, label is DellUtility.
 ùgood : pbr4 is fat32, label is DellRestore.
 ùgood : reference partition table in sync.
 
It seems like the restore partition is there but not at the "expected" location for DSR. Can someone please tell me how I can recover?
